Is There a Sacred Framework for Interpreting Dreams with Divine Messages?

Yes, many spiritual traditions offer frameworks for interpreting divine messages in dreams. In Islamic dream interpretation, for instance, sacred symbols are viewed as direct communication from Allah or angels, carrying specific meanings contingent on context, scene, and personal circumstances. As documented in Islamic scholarly sources, this approach emphasizes sincerity, contextual understanding, and reliance on authentic sources to decode divine messages accurately.

Incorporating such frameworks involves cultivating a conscious state before sleep, maintaining a dream journal, and seeking guidance from knowledgeable sources. Over time, this disciplined approach fosters a nuanced understanding of divine symbols, transforming dreams into powerful tools for spiritual guidance and divine alignment.
